Default First drive impressions, post-LS1 swap

Well, the TR224-equipped LS1 is in! I drove it home last night and I just can't beleive the difference already! Since we completely rebuilt the motor, I'm being very easy on her and have yet to go full throttle, or over 4000 rpm. And, it's still running on the factory 4.8 tune!

But I can say that torque is INSTANTLY available. The cammed LR4 was very peaky and pulled hard up top, where the LS1 has enough torque below 3000 rpm to loose traction at 1/2-3/4 throttle.

I can't wait to get this thing broken in! I want to romp on it sooooo bad, but I'm being a good little boy and holding back.

The swap seemed fairly easy. I don't understand why the General just doesn't offer this motor or the 6.0 in ALL of the trucks!
